What to check before for buildings with low open violation rates near the M3 bus in Hamilton Heights

  • Use the filters together: confirm the building is actually a walkable option to the M3 route, not just in the same ZIP area.
  • For low open-violation rates, treat them as a starting signal from NYC open records; ask the super/management what’s currently in progress and how quickly issues get closed.
  • Check lease fundamentals before you tour: rent, renewal terms, move-in costs, and who pays for utilities—open-violation history does not change those basics.
  • Request documentation for any restricted items or processes your application needs (e.g., background checks, documentation requirements), since policies vary by building and management.
  • Compare rated buildings, not just counts: use the overall rating and read the most recent feedback to see whether concerns match what you’re worried about.
